Key Deal Facts

Team previously ran and sold two other software companies ($200k+ revenue)
Built Artemis to solve real problems encountered in Caltech aerospace robotics lab
Clients include teams at Mayo Clinic and the US Dept. of Veterans Affairs
YC backed, raised 750k so far including from notable VCs like Remus and Amino Capital

Management Team / Advisory Board Bios

Austin McCoy Co-Founder & CEOSumma cum laude Caltech CS graduate. Built Artemis to solve problems he faced performing aerospace research published in Science Robotics. Brought together two lifelong friends to create our team., Manvir Singh Co-Founder & CTOSoftware engineer who has coordinated with Austin in previous ventures., Kyle Hooten Co-Founder & COOFormer White House appointee to US Dept. of Commerce.

Security Description

A CAFES (Contract and Future Equity Stake) can convert into different types of equity upon a Triggering Event, such as: common or preferred stock for a corporation, limited partnership interest for a limited partnership and membership interest for a limited liability company. At the time of the Triggering Event, the specific rights and limitations associated with the equity stake being issued to the investors will be determined and disclosed by the Entrepreneur.
